Exhaust Manifold with Catalytic Converter Replacement (LUW)

Removal Procedure

WARNINGRefer to Exhaust Service Warning .
  1. Remove the drivetrain and front suspension frame skid plate. Refer to «Drivetrain and Front Suspension Frame Skid Plate Replacement»(ref-542501-S42788884472013041600000) .
  2. Disconnect the heated oxygen sensor-2. Refer to «Heated Oxygen Sensor Replacement - Sensor 2»(ref-542510-S11424779042013041600000) .
  3. Remove the 3-way catalytic converter fasteners (1) and disconnect the 3-way catalytic converter (4) from the front pipe.
  4. Discard the exhaust gasket (2).
  5. Remove the exhaust front pipe (3) to the catalytic converter fasteners (1).
  6. Remove the front pipe (3) from the catalytic converter and discard the exhaust gasket (2).

Installation Procedure

  1. Install a NEW gasket (2) to the exhaust front pipe.
  2. Install the 3-way catalytic converter (4) to the exhaust isolators (3) and tighten the fasteners (1) to 17 N.m (13 lb ft).
  3. Position the exhaust front pipe (3) to the catalytic converter with a NEW gasket (2).
  4. Install the exhaust front pipe fasteners (1) to the catalytic converter and tighten to 20 N.m (15 lb ft).
  5. Connect the heated oxygen sensor-2. Refer to «Heated Oxygen Sensor Replacement - Sensor 2»(ref-542510-S11424779042013041600000) .
  6. Install the drivetrain and front suspension frame skid plate. Refer to «Drivetrain and Front Suspension Frame Skid Plate Replacement»(ref-542501-S42788884472013041600000) .
  7. Start the engine and check for exhaust leaks.

  1. Remove the exhaust manifold heat shield. Refer to «Exhaust Manifold Heat Shield Replacement (LUV)»(ref-542543-S09598436702013041600000) , «Exhaust Manifold Heat Shield Replacement (LUW)»(ref-542543-S02756170052013041600000) .
  2. Remove the catalytic converter heated oxygen sensor - 1. Refer to «Heated Oxygen Sensor Replacement - Sensor 1»(ref-542528-S27806594812013041600000) .
  3. Remove the catalytic converter to the turbocharger clamp fastener (1) and discard the clamp (2).
  4. Raise and support the vehicle. Refer to «Lifting and Jacking the Vehicle»(ref-542467-S12591948612013041600000) .
  5. Remove the drivetrain and front suspension frame skid plate. Refer to «Drivetrain and Front Suspension Frame Skid Plate Replacement»(ref-542501-S42788884472013041600000) .
  6. Remove the exhaust front pipe fasteners (1) and discard the exhaust gasket (2).
  7. Remove the catalytic converter brace fasteners (1) from the catalytic converter brace (2).
  8. Remove the catalytic converter.
  1. Install the catalytic converter into the catalytic converter brace (2) and loosely tighten the fasteners (1).
  2. Install a NEW clamp into the position shown and loosely tighten the clamp fastener (1).
  3. Install the exhaust front pipe (3) to the catalytic converter with a NEW gasket (2) and tighten the fasteners (1) to 22 N.m (16 lb ft).
  4. Tighten the catalytic converter brace fasteners (1) to 22 N.m (16 lb ft).
  5. Install the drivetrain and front suspension frame skid plate. Refer to «Drivetrain and Front Suspension Frame Skid Plate Replacement»(ref-542501-S42788884472013041600000) .
  6. Lower the vehicle.
  7. Tighten the turbocharge clamp fastener (1) to 13 N.m (115 lb in).
  8. Install the exhaust manifold heat shield. Refer to «Exhaust Manifold Heat Shield Replacement (LUV)»(ref-542543-S09598436702013041600000) , «Exhaust Manifold Heat Shield Replacement (LUW)»(ref-542543-S02756170052013041600000) .
  9. Install the catalytic converter heated oxygen sensor - 1. Refer to «Heated Oxygen Sensor Replacement - Sensor 1»(ref-542528-S27806594812013041600000) .
  10. Start the engine and check for exhaust leaks.

Exhaust Rear Muffler Heat Shield Replacement

WARNINGRefer to Exhaust Service Warning .
  1. Raise and support the vehicle. Refer to «Lifting and Jacking the Vehicle»(ref-542467-S12591948612013041600000) .
  2. Cut the exhaust rear muffler (2) with the CH-6614 pipe cutter at position (1).
  3. Remove the rear exhaust muffler (2) from the exhaust isolators (1).
  4. Sand smooth the front exhaust pipe for ease of installation.
  1. Install the new rear exhaust muffler (2) into the exhaust isolators.
  2. Position the exhaust front pipe (3) into the exhaust muffler clamp.
  3. Install the rear exhaust muffler (2) into the exhaust muffler clamp and tighten the bolt (1) to 50 N.m (37 lb ft).
  4. Lower the vehicle.
  5. Start the engine and check for exhaust leaks.
